Self-guided rail journey from London through Alps to Slovenia's coast and lakes

Discover Slovenia is a self-guided 11-day rail holiday run by Tailor Made Rail that departs London and arrives in Amsterdam, threading through Turin, the Adriatic coastal town of Piran, Slovenia's capital Ljubljana, and Lake Bled in the Julian Alps. The journey combines express rail across Europe with slower regional trains through the Alpine valleys and Slovenian countryside. On Day 1, you take Eurostar to Paris, transfer by metro, then board the TGV across the Alps via the Fréjus Tunnel into Turin. After exploring Turin's role as Italy's first capital, you travel by rail through Milan and Verona to the coast, then continue inland to Ljubljana and Lake Bled, where you hike to viewpoints, swim, and tour the lake by traditional boat. The trip returns you to Amsterdam aboard a sleeper train from Vienna, arriving the next morning. This trip suits independent rail travellers with some station experience and couples seeking multi-night stays in each destination.
Eurostar to Paris, metro transfer from Gare du Nord to Gare de Lyon, then TGV across the Alps via the Fréjus Tunnel into Turin.
Morning exploring Turin, the first capital of Italy, then a direct train across northern Italy via Milan, Verona and Venice to Trieste, with a private transfer on to Piran.
Wander the car-free medieval centre and Tartinijev trg, with visits possible to Portoroz's casino or the port city of Koper.
Further free time exploring Piran and the surrounding Adriatic coast.
Private transfer to Koper, then a direct afternoon train through rolling hills into Slovenia's capital, Ljubljana, for a 2-night stay.
Explore the mix of Roman, Baroque, Vienna Succession and Art Deco architecture; recommended boat tour on the Ljubljanica. TMR recommends extending with a side-visit to Maribor.
Open ticket to travel from Ljubljana to Lesce Bled station, around an hour's journey, for a 3-night stay by Lake Bled.
Walk the lake shore, take a traditional Pletna boat to the island church, or hire rowing boats and paddleboards.
Hike to the Ojstrica viewpoint for panoramic views, and sample the famous Bled cream cake at a lakeside café.
Bus from Bled village across the Austrian border to Villach, then the high-speed line to Vienna to board a sleeper service bound for Amsterdam.
Arrive in Amsterdam this morning and connect onto the Eurostar for the return journey to London.
